- Abstract : Background: Exaggerated oscillatory activity in the beta frequency band in the subthalamic nucleus has been suggested to be related to bradykinesia in Parkinson's disease (PD). However, past studies have been limited to recordings obtained in the postoperative, stun-effect affected period, and have seldom reported evidence of this effect within, as opposed to across, patients. Methods: Here we investigate how beta power dynamics in the local field potential relate to changes in kinematic parameters in an upper limb alternating pronation and supination task in PD patients several months after neurostimulator implantation. Local field potentials were recorded from a fully implanted pulse generator (Activa PC+S, Medtronic, Inc.) and motor performance simultaneously tracked. Results: While beta power was suppressed during repeated movements, this suppression progressively fell off in tandem with a decrement in the frequency and speed of movements over time. This was significant both within and across patients. Discussion: These findings provide further evidence that beta power may serve as a biomarker for bradykinesia and thus be a suitable feedback input for chronic adaptive deep brain stimulation.
